Abstract

When a main switch () is turned ON, an electric operating machine () is put in the standby mode. With a trigger () being pulled in the standby mode, a power supply circuit () applies a voltage to a drive part (). The power supply circuit () adjusts the voltage applied to the drive part () for a voltage corresponding to the pulling rate of the trigger (). When the current running toward the drive part () exceeds the rated value of the drive part (), the power supply circuit () automatically stops power supply to the drive part (). On the other hand, when the output voltage of a battery () drops and the battery () is put in an overdischarge state, power supply to the drive part () is automatically stopped. When it is detected that the battery () undergoes an abnormal event, power supply to the drive part () is automatically stopped.
